Oh, Voguing was indeed a thing, however brief. I was living on Manhattan when Madonna released her video and I recall friends — better connected than I — remarking that she was simply capitalizing on a trend that had been going on for a while in gay dance clubs in Manhattan.

The “Martin Short plays a boy” joint, Clifford, was filmed in 1990, but didn’t come out in theaters until 1994 because the studio that produced it went bankrupt. There is a party scene in the film that has Clifford voguing, and even the eight-year-old me found the reference jarring and dated.Woof wrote: ↑Wed Jul 11, 2018 10:27 amOh, Voguing was indeed a thing, however brief.
